I got an e-mail from NCWW this morning wishing me a happy birthday so I know that my birthday date is logged in correctly, but I don't show up in todays birthdays. Is this a program glitch? Not that I want to get any older, but I am curious.
 

SteveColes

Steve
Corporate Member
In your options, you have "display age only". If you the code that that displays birthdays publicly, displayed your age, it would be indirectly displaying your birth date and thus be a violation of your privacy options.

So the system can send private birthday messages, but not public ones.
